manufacturing suppliers play a crucial role in the success of many businesses. From providing raw materials to producing finished goods, these suppliers are an essential part of the supply chain for manufacturing companies. In this article, we will explore the importance of manufacturing suppliers and how they contribute to the overall success of businesses.
One of the main reasons why manufacturing suppliers are essential for businesses is their ability to provide high-quality materials and components. Businesses rely on these suppliers to deliver the raw materials needed to produce their products. Without a reliable source of materials, businesses would struggle to meet their production deadlines and deliver high-quality products to their customers.
manufacturing suppliers also play a key role in helping businesses reduce their production costs. By sourcing materials and components from suppliers, businesses can take advantage of economies of scale and negotiate better prices. This allows businesses to lower their production costs and increase their profit margins.
In addition to providing materials, manufacturing suppliers also offer expertise and technical support to businesses. Many suppliers have extensive knowledge of the materials they provide and can help businesses optimize their production processes. This can lead to improved efficiency, lower production costs, and higher quality products.
Furthermore, manufacturing suppliers can help businesses stay competitive in the market. By providing access to the latest technology and innovations, suppliers can help businesses improve their products and stay ahead of their competitors. This can be especially important in industries where advancements in technology occur rapidly.
Another benefit of working with manufacturing suppliers is their ability to provide flexibility and agility to businesses. Suppliers can quickly adjust their production schedules and supply chain to meet the changing needs of businesses. This can be especially important in industries where demand fluctuates frequently.

When selecting manufacturing suppliers, businesses should consider several factors to ensure they choose the right partner. Businesses should evaluate the supplier’s reputation, quality of materials, pricing, delivery times, and customer service. It is also important to establish clear communication channels and expectations with suppliers to ensure a successful partnership.
